BIO 215 - Cross-Sectional Anatomy


Examines cross-sectional anatomy in which the student learns to view the human body in transverse perspectives in this comprehensive study. Discusses abdominal, cardio- pulmonary, cranial, obstetric and gynecological structures and the application to ultrasound images. Cadaver cross and sagittal sections, other models and photographs are also used to gain an understanding of the cross-sectional anatomy of the body. (Enrollment is limited to ultrasound program students)

Co-requisites: NONE

Prerequisites: BIO 211  

Credits: 2(Lab: 6)
